JIM ROSS
Jim Ross, or famously referred to as "Good Ole J.R.", has been one of wrestling’s most influential
figures, both as an executive and as the most recognizable announcer in the business. Known to
sports entertainment fans around the world as the Voice of Professional Wrestling, J.R. has nearly
done it all. He has traveled the world and had a ringside seat for some of the most amazing
moments in pro wrestling history, while being welcomed into the homes of millions of viewers each
and every week.
In April 2017, J.R. signed a new contract with WWE, making a surprise guest appearance to call the
Undertaker’s apparent last match at WrestleMania 33. Good Ole J.R. entertains fans with his weekly
Ross Report podcast and is still a fixture on television through his broadcast work for New Japan Pro
Wrestling on Mark Cuban’s AXS Network. He also calls the play-by-play for boxing on CBS,
alongside Al Bernstein.
Over the course of his illustrious career, he broadcasted football games at nearly every level and
league, including the NFL, high school and college, and was a football, basketball and baseball
official. Outside of sports entertainment, Ross is a New York Times bestselling author, barbecue
sauce entrepreneur and steadfast advocate for Bell’s palsy, a disease which has affected him since
1994, in addition to being the National Chairman of Headlock on Hunger. He is also an avid
supporter of the Oklahoma Sooners football team, and can often be found along the sidelines of their
games.
Nowadays, he spends time with his fans on the road, sharing his life story via his one-man show:
RINGSIDE with Jim Ross. With his signature 200X Resistol hat and renowned southern charm,
RINGSIDE with Jim Ross allows fans to get up close and personal with Ross and the world of sports
entertainment. J.R. shares stories and anecdotes from his time with legends such as Stone Cold
Steve Austin, The Rock and Mick Foley, to his recruiting and hiring of modern day superstars like
John Cena and Brock Lesnar during his tenure as WWE’s EVP of Talent Relations. From ringside to
backstage, over a span of four decades, Ross was present for nearly all of pro wrestling’s
memorable clashes and spectacular moments, giving him an insider’s view on the sport, industry
and its superstars. No stone remains unturned during his tell-all, intimate and interactive event.
